The Life Scientific - Rosalie David on the science of Egyptian mummies - Â鶹ÊÓƵAV Sounds

The Life Scientific - Rosalie David on the science of Egyptian mummies - Â鶹ÊÓƵAV Sounds


Rosalie David on the science of Egyptian mummies

Rosalie David on what mummies reveal about life, death and medicine in ancient Egypt

Coming Up Next